Softball Splits Opening Day at Spring Games

CLERMONT, Fla. - The William Paterson softball team (3-1) split two games on the first day of the Spring Games on March 15. The Pioneers defeated McDaniel College (2-5) 7-1 and fell to Augsburg University (3-9) 9-6.

GAME ONE

HOW IT HAPPENED:

  • WP jumped out to an early advantage in the first inning. Senior Brandi Shortway (Midland Park, N.J./Midland Park) drew a walk before moving to second on a sacrifice bunt by freshman Gianna Capone (Toms River, N.J./Toms River East). After moving to third later in the inning, Shortway came home when sophomore Kelsey Geurts (South Plainfield, N.J./South Plainfield) worked a bases-loaded walk to make the score 1-0.

  • In the bottom of the second, sophomore Stephanie Ciravolo (Marlboro, N.J./Marlboro) singled down the left field line before crossing the plate on Shortway's triple to left field (2-0). Shortway then scored on a passed ball to extend its lead to 3-0.

  • WP added another run in the bottom of the fourth to make it 4-0. Shortway singled and moved to second before scoring on a fielding error in right field off the bat of Aubrey Miller (Sewell, N.J./Gloucester County Institute of Technology).  

  • McDaniel scored a run in fifth to cut the deficit to 4-1.

  • WP responded in the bottom half of the inning, plating two more runs to build a 6-1 advantage. Guerts walked and later scored on an RBI double to right center by Ciravolo (5-1). Ciravolo's hit also moved pinch runner sophomore Rylie Nagle (Ridgefield Park, N.J./Ridgefield Park) to third who later came home on a sacrifice fly delivered by Shortway (6-1).

  • Freshman Mackenzie Crowe pinch hit for senior Kylie Anthony (Methuen, Mass./Methuen) in the sixth inning, reaching on an error before moving to third on a single by senior Hailey Backo (Wallington, N.J./Wallington). Junior Molly Cocco's (Florham Park, N.J./Hanover Park) single through the left side drove home Backo to put the Pioneers up 7-1.

 

INSIDE THE NUMBERS:

  • Shortway went 3-for-3 with a triple, a sacrifice fly, three RBIs, and two runs scored.

  • Ciravolo finished 2-for-3 with a double, one RBI, and one run scored. 

  • Guerts went 1-for-2 with one RBI, one stolen base, and one run scored.

  • Backo added a 1-for-3 performance with a single, one stolen base, and one run scored.

  • Sophomore Aubrey Miller (Sewell, N.J./Gloucester County Institute of Technology) earned the win, tossing 4.2 innings while allowing five hits, one earned run, and striking out five. 

 

GAME TWO

HOW IT HAPPENED:

  • In the top of the first, Shortway worked a walk before advancing to third on a wild pitch, and then scored on an RBI groundout by junior Megan Tinger (Garwood, N.J./Arthur L. Johnson) to give the Pioneers an early 1-0 lead. 

  • In the next inning, Geurts led off with a walk before advancing to third on a pair of throwing errors. Junior Samantha Campos (River Edge, N.J./River Dell) delivered a sacrifice fly to drive in Guerts. 

  • WP increased its lead to 2–0 in the inning. Senior Lilah Guthy (Stroudsburg, Pa./Stroudsburg) reached on a throwing error by right field, advancing to second on the play, and Kelsey Geurts (South Plainfield, N.J./South Plainfield) eventually scored on a sacrifice fly by Samantha Campos (River Edge, N.J./River Dell). 

  • Backo led off the top of the fourth with a triple to right-center before scoring on a single delivered by Senior Gabriella Vazquez (Parsippany, N.J./Parsippany Hills) (3-0) Later, Shortway doubled to left field to drive in Campos and Vazquez to extend the lead to 5-0.

  • Augsburg got on the board in the bottom of the fourth, trimming WP's lead to 5–1. The Auggies then scored seven runs in the fifth and added another in the sixth to take a 9–5 advantage over the Pioneers.

  • Miller led off the top of the seventh with a single up the middle. Sophomore Rylie Nagle (Ridgefield Park, N.J./Ridgefield Park) came in to  pinch run for Miller and scored on Backo's double to center to make the final score 9-6.

 

INSIDE THE NUMBERS:

  • Backo finished 3-for-4 with a double, triple, stolen base, an RBI and one run scored.

  • Shortway went 2-for-2 with a stolen base, two RBIs, and two runs scored.
